What Venus in the Eleventh house means
Venus in the Eleventh house centers love and aesthetics around community and shared goals. People with this placement prefer relationships that feel like partnerships in a larger cause. They often value friends as much as romantic partners. Social networks supply emotional nourishment and opportunities for beauty and harmony. In short, connection with groups matters more than traditional one-on-one romance.

How Venus in the Eleventh house affects friendships and groups
Friendship often serves as the primary arena for Venusian expression here. People with this placement invest emotionally in clubs, teams, and movements. They look for like-minded companions and feel fulfilled when group values align with personal taste. Also, they may prefer egalitarian bonds where affection flows freely rather than follows formal roles. Because of that, betrayals or exclusion can hurt deeply, so they prioritize inclusivity.
Venus in the Eleventh house in romantic life
Romance tends to feel social and platonic at first. These individuals may meet partners through friends or shared causes. They want a lover who blends easily into their social circle. Also, they often expect partnership to support mutual ideals and long-term projects. For commitment, they prefer arrangements that allow independence within a shared vision. Consequently, they thrive with partners who respect their social life and collaborative impulses.

Potential challenges and growth paths
A common challenge lies in idealism. They may expect groups to embody high ethics or perfect harmony. When reality falls short, disappointment can follow. Another issue involves boundary blur: they might merge too much with groups and lose personal direction. Growth requires realistic expectations and clear personal limits. Practice saying no when needed, and choose causes that match your deepest values. In time, you can balance idealism with practical steps for sustained impact.
